Woking 0-2 York
York ended a run of six games without a win with an impressive victory over nine-man Woking.
Ben Wilkinson steered in Ben Purkiss's cross to give the visitors the lead just after the hour.
Craig Farrell played in Daniel McBreen who flashed his shot past Millwall keeper Lenny Pidgeley to double the lead six minutes later.
Woking had Tom Hutchinson and Bradley Quamina sent off in the closing stages, both for two bookable offences.
